Town and Country Planning (Scotland) Act 1997 (c. 8)

20.  In section 216 of the Town and Country Planning (Scotland) Act 1997, in subsection (6) (which defines certain terms relating to what constitutes specific planning permission for the purposes of the section)–

(a)at the end of paragraph (b)(ii), “or” is omitted; and

(b)at the end of paragraph (b)(iii) there is inserted–

;or

(iv)by an order which has been brought into operation in accordance with the provisions of the Scotland Act 1998 (Transitory and Transitional Provisions) (Orders subject to Special Parliamentary Procedure) Order 1999(1) or of an enactment comprised in, or contained in an instrument made under, an Act of the Scottish Parliament providing, or making provision for, the special procedure referred to in section 94(2) of the Scotland Act 1998.
